Independence Park is a park, at a modelled 9 m. Seefin East Top stands 491 m to the west-northwest, 23 miles off. The nearest named place is Douglas Park, a park 0.3 miles away. Wild Atlantic Way passes 12 miles off. 33 named summits stand within 25 miles.
